Actress Sthandwa Nzuza has a new reality TV show.

The 40-year-old is to host Molao O Reng, which will premiere on Thursday at 7pm on Moja Love. Sthandwa is known for her acting roles in Ehostela, Uzalo, Durban Gen and Umkhokha, among others.

Speaking to TshisaLIVE, Sthandwa says it has been a long journey for her in the entertainment industry.

“I did all this while I was a student at DUT studying drama and production. I have enjoyed every part of my journey. Molao O Reng is the first project I’m doing as a 'TV host'. I’ve only been a radio host and actress and I’m humbled and thankful to Moja Love for believing in my capabilities,” she said.

Molao O Reng aims to champion and challenge the law and provide legal access for all. It’s a multilingual show, which makes it more interesting. Sthandwa said she comes in with her isiZulu and the panel come in with their languages.

“I wouldn’t say challenges. I catch on environments easily — I’m used to cameras when acting. The difference with TV presenting is you need to look directly at the camera, while in acting it’s the opposite. I just took my radio presenting experience and put it on camera,” she said.

The Inanda-born actress said she's shooting another show and she can’t talk about it now due to confidentiality.

"⁠Molao O Reng viewers can expect raw or real life experiences from different cases that will be revealed on the show every Thursday. We discuss issues I’m sure affect 99% of South Africans in every household, one way or the other. They will also get advice from the panel of lawyers or advocates I have on the show to give guidance in the cases.”
